What are Window Hinges?
Window hinges are mechanical gadgets that permit a window to pivot open and closed. They are created to support the weight of the window while offering smooth operation. Numerous types of hinges exist, and each is fit to various window styles (e.g., casement, awning, sliding).

To value window hinges fully, one need to understand the elements that make them work. Here's a list of the vital parts of window hinges:
Hinge Pin: The metal rod that enables the hinge to rotate. It is important for the movement of the window.Leaf: The flat plate that is attached to either the window frame or the window sash.
